Dosecast features and specs

  • Medication Reminder
    Dosecast provides timely medication reminders, helping users adhere to their medication schedules and prevent missed doses.
  • Compatibility
    The app is available on both iOS and Android platforms, making it accessible to a wide range of smartphone users.
  • Customizable Alerts
    Users can customize alert times and frequencies to suit their individual medication needs and preferences.
  • Offline Functionality
    Dosecast can function without an internet connection, ensuring users receive reminders even in areas with poor connectivity.
  • Comprehensive Tracking
    The app allows for detailed tracking of medication history, providing users insights into their adherence over time.

Possible disadvantages of Dosecast

  • Paid Features
    Some advanced features require a paid subscription, which may not be suitable for all users.
  • User Interface
    Some users may find the user interface less intuitive compared to other medication reminder apps.
  • Limited Integrations
    Dosecast has limited integration with other health apps and platforms, which might be a drawback for users looking for comprehensive health tracking.
  • Learning Curve
    New users might experience a learning curve when initially setting up and navigating the app.

React Engine features and specs

  • Isomorphic rendering
    React Engine enables both server-side and client-side rendering of React components, providing a seamless isomorphic/universal JavaScript experience. This allows for faster initial page loads and better SEO while maintaining rich client-side interactivity.
  • Express.js integration
    React Engine is designed as a view engine for Express.js, making it easy to integrate React into existing Express-based applications with minimal configuration. It follows familiar Express conventions for setting up view engines.
  • Built-in React Router support
    The library comes with built-in support for React Router, enabling developers to easily set up server-side and client-side routing without complex manual configuration.
  • PayPal backing
    React Engine was developed and maintained by PayPal, which provided credibility and ensured it was battle-tested in a large-scale production environment before being open-sourced.
  • Simplified setup
    The library abstracts away much of the complexity involved in setting up server-side rendering with React, reducing boilerplate code and allowing developers to get a universal React application running quickly.

Possible disadvantages of React Engine

  • Abandoned project
    The repository appears to be no longer actively maintained, with no recent commits or updates. This makes it risky to use in production as bugs and security vulnerabilities may go unpatched.
  • Outdated dependencies
    React Engine was built for older versions of React and React Router. It may not be compatible with modern versions of React (16+, 17, 18) or React Router (v5, v6), limiting its usefulness in current projects.
  • Limited ecosystem support
    The library is tightly coupled to Express.js, meaning it cannot be easily used with other Node.js frameworks like Koa, Hapi, or Fastify, reducing its flexibility.
  • Better modern alternatives
    Modern tools like Next.js, Remix, and Vite with SSR plugins provide far more comprehensive and well-maintained solutions for server-side rendering with React, making React Engine largely obsolete.
  • Limited documentation and community
    The project has relatively sparse documentation and a small community, making it difficult for new developers to troubleshoot issues or find examples and best practices for advanced use cases.
